Dengue on prowl as 41 new cases reported across KP

PESHAWAR, Nov 10 (APP):Dengue cases continue to rise across Khyber Pakhtunkhwa, including the provincial capital Peshawar, as the health department confirmed 41 new cases in the latest report on Monday.
According to the Khyber Pakhtunkhwa Health Department, there are currently 390 active dengue cases in the province. So far this year, a total of 5,497 dengue cases have been reported.
During the last 24 hours,10 new patients have been admitted to various hospitals, bringing the total number of hospitalized dengue patients to 29 across the province.
The report further stated that since the beginning of the year, 1,915 patients have been admitted to hospitals, of which 5,105 have recovered, while two deaths have been recorded due to the virus.
Apart from Peshawar, there are 8 patients in Nowshera, 12 in Mardan, 4 in Charsadda, 3 in Kohat, and 2 in Abbottabad currently under treatment.
Health officials have urged the public to take preventive measures and eliminate mosquito breeding sites to control the spread of dengue.
